Mabel-Canton waltzed into their match on Friday with four straight wins... but they left with five. They came out on top against the Kittson Central/Lancaster Bearcats by a score of 2-0. The Cougars have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Bearcats, too.

Mabel-Canton's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Gwenyth Rein, who had 18 assists and eight digs. Rein is crushing it when it comes to assists: she's posted at least 14 every time she's taken the court this season. The team also got some help courtesy of Lauren Burke, who had seven digs and one assist.
Mabel-Canton's victory bumped their record up to 19-1. As for Kittson Central/Lancaster,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 9-5.
Mabel-Canton did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 2-0 loss against Mayer Lutheran on the 20th. As for Kittson Central/Lancaster,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 2-1 defeat against Pine River-Backus on the 20th.
